47-year-old Sgt. Parnell Guyton of UAB Police, was transferred to a rehabilitation unit after 59-days of being hospitalized in an intensive care unit with COVID-19 since March 31.

UAB Police Sergeant gets discharged from COVID-19 ICU unit after 59 days
